How much does it cost to rent a home in Burke Centre?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Burke Centre 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,950 | $1,950 | $1,950 |
Burke Centre 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,061 | $2,400 | $4,195 |
Burke Centre 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,871 | $2,800 | $5,000 |
Burke Centre 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,166 | $4,500 | $5,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Burke Centre
What type of rentals are currently available in Burke Centre?
There are currently 14 Apartments for Rent in Burke Centre, VA with pricing that ranges from $1,339 to $9,533. There are also 37 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Burke Centre ranging from $900 to $5,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Burke Centre?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Burke Centre ranges from $900 to $5,500 with an average monthly rent of $3,102.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Burke Centre?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Burke Centre range from $2,428 to $9,533,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,400 to $4,195.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,800 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,339.
